Idokorro Launches the Citrix Presentation Server Client for BlackBerry
Ottawa, ON, March 26, 2007 - Idokorro Mobile Inc., the leading innovator in
mobile access solutions and provider of award-winning applications for wireless
handhelds, is pleased to announce today's launch of their Citrix Presentation
Server™ Client for BlackBerry®. Idokorro's solution gives BlackBerry users the
ability to access and use any Windows application that is deployed on the Citrix
Presentation platform.
Citrix Presentation Server™ Client for BlackBerry is a hotly anticipated
solution for BlackBerry and Citrix users, giving them the ability to run
Citrix-published applications like the Microsoft Office Suite, SAP, PeopleSoft,
Crystal Reports, Cognos management tools and their Desktop-even view the
graphical windows and control the mouse and keyboard-directly from a BlackBerry
smartphone. By delivering a secure and reliable way for mobile employees to
access important corporate resources, Citrix Presentation Server™ Client for
BlackBerry significantly extends the value of both the Citrix Presentation
Server platform and the BlackBerry wireless solution by increasing employee
efficiency and productivity.

Citrix Presentation Server™ Client for BlackBerry is part of the Idokorro suite
of applications for wireless handhelds that give users secure access to
networks, servers, desktops and other devices, allowing most computing tasks to
be performed from almost anywhere. The Idokorro suite currently consists of
Mobile Admin, Mobile SSH, Mobile Desktop and Mobile File Manager. Mobile Admin
allows IT administrators to use their wireless handheld to manage network
servers including Microsoft Windows, Active Directory, Exchange, SQL; Lotus
Domino; Oracle; Citrix Presentation Server; BlackBerry Enterprise Servers and
much more. Mobile SSH supports full VT100, 5250 and 3270 terminal emulation so
users can access and manage a wide range of network devices including Unix,
Linux, Novell Netware, AS/400 servers, IBM mainframes, routers and switches.
Mobile Desktop is a Remote Desktop and VNC client that lets users access
computers from their wireless handheld, even view the desktop and control the
mouse and keyboard. Mobile File Manager, designed for BlackBerry smartphones, is
a professional file manager for remote and local files and supports Windows File
Sharing, WebDAV, FTP and SFTP connections.
